【问题标题】:Facebook Graph API User object subscriptions WhitelistingFacebook Graph API 用户对象订阅白名单
【发布时间】:2015-02-04 21:37:03
【问题描述】:

在我的 iPhone 应用程序中,我实现了 Facebook API,以捎带他们的用户身份。

现在,我想使用“用户对象订阅”,而不是每隔一段时间轮询 Facebook 以查看登录用户的信息是否已更改。从this 文档中我了解到,我必须创建一个回调 URL (done, and tested),并且我的应用需要被列入白名单。

在 developers.facebook.com/apps/ 上我找不到申请被列入白名单的方法,而且 Google 似乎不再是我的朋友了。

我希望是。

【问题讨论】:

    标签: ios facebook-graph-api


    【解决方案1】:

    文档说明

    ...其中一些对象可能要求您的应用被 Facebook 列入白名单才能访问。

    基本实时更新应该在不涉及任何白名单的情况下工作,至少他们为我自己这样做。

    【讨论】:

    • 但是我的应用程序如何发现发生了变化的事实?是它需要检查的标志吗?我意识到这是另一个问题
    • 好吧,我以为您已经按照developers.facebook.com/docs/graph-api/real-time-updates/… 中的描述设置了一个回调 url,再次阅读文档。对于每次更改,FB 都会通过 POST 请求调用您的回调 URL。您还需要按照developers.facebook.com/docs/graph-api/reference/v2.2/app/… 中的说明发布应用的订阅。
    • 好吧,那么我的问题是,我找不到放置回调 URL 的地方。我唯一能找到的地方与我不感兴趣的广告对象有关。
    • 查看文档!这是我在上一条评论中发布的第二个链接!
    • 我快疯了。我已经盯着界面看了好几个小时了,但实际上,没有用户 Graph API 对象的迹象。这就是为什么我认为我需要被列入白名单。或者,也许我只是个盲人。您能否以您对 4 岁孩子的方式向我解释,在登录到 developers.facebook.com/apps/ 并单击我的应用程序后,我应该单击哪些按钮?
    【解决方案2】:

    将您的应用列入白名单并不总是那么容易,因为某些 API 在开发人员级别上会受到严格限制。如果您还没有这样做,您可以找到有关将here 列入白名单的更多信息。

    至于白名单,就您而言,我认为这只是您的应用设置和 IP 白名单的问题,您可以找到有关 here 的更多信息。

    【讨论】:

    • 您好 Elizion,您的第一个链接似乎是死链接,您指的表格是申请“Facebook Ads API 标准访问申请”,这不是我有兴趣。
    猜你喜欢
    • 1970-01-01
    • 2016-01-06
    • 1970-01-01
    • 2015-05-04
    • 1970-01-01
    • 2011-08-12
    • 1970-01-01
    • 1970-01-01
    • 2022-11-04
    相关资源
    最近更新 更多